- 1、本文档共120页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
FPGA设计高级进阶
FPGA 设计高级进阶
贺 光 辉
清华大学电子工程系
hgh02@
1
目标
• 掌握FPGA的基本设计原则
• 乒乓结构、流水线设计
• 异步时钟域的处理
• 状态机的设计
• 毛刺的消除
• 掌握FPGA设计的注意事项
• 从文档到设计完成
• 从设计实例加深设计思想
2
提纲
•FPGA的基本设计原则
•FPGA设计的注意事项
• 设计实例
•交织器
•数据适配器
•基于PCI接口的数字电视计算机终端通
信接口芯片
3
推荐书籍
• Verilog
• Verilog数字系统设计教程 夏宇闻 北京航天航空大学出版社
• 硬件描述语言Verilog 刘明业等译 清华大学出版社
• FPGA
• 基于FPGA的系统设计(英文版) Wayne Wolf 机械工业出版社
• Altera FPGA/CPLD设计(高级篇) EDA先锋工作室 人民邮电出版
社
• IC 设计
• Reuse methodology manual for system-on-a-chip designs 3r
d ed. Michael Keating, Pierre Bricaud.
• 片上系统:可重用设计方法学沈戈,等译电子工业出版社, 2004
• Writing testbenches : functional verification of HDL mod
els / Janick Bergeron Boston : Kluwer Academic, c2000
4
推荐文章
• /papers/
• Verilog Coding Styles For Improved Simulation Efficiency
• State Machine Coding Styles for Synthesis
• Synthesis and Scripting Techniques for Designing Multi-Asynchr
onous Clock Designs
• Synchronous Resets? Asynchronous Resets? I am so confused!
• Nonblocking Assignments in Verilog Synthesis, Coding Styles Th
at Kill!
5
FPGA 设计的两条思路
• 控制通路(上午)
• 有限状态机的设计
• 异步时钟域的处理
• 数据通路(下午DSP)
• 关注算法到结构的映射
6
FPGA 设计基本原则
7
目标
• 完成本单元的学习后你将会
• 加深FPGA设计常用的设计思想和技巧
•了解为什么才用流水线设计
•掌握处理异步时钟的方法
•掌握状
您可能关注的文档
最近下载
- 《《机械创新设计》课程标准.doc VIP
- 小学残疾儿童送教上门教案(40篇).pdf
- 菜品知识培训.pptx
- 旅游收入与分配-(精选·公开·课件).ppt
- 2023年长三角一体化示范区苏州湾投资发展(江苏)有限公司人员招聘考试参考题库及答案解析.docx
- 高压氧治疗对于颈椎病患者的影响分析.pptx
- 2021年长三角一体化示范区苏州湾投资发展(江苏)有限公司招聘试题及答案解析.docx
- 尼可地尔夜景游览欣赏岛上迷人的夜间灯光和美景.pptx
- 2023年长三角一体化示范区苏州湾投资发展(江苏)有限公司招聘考试试题及答案解析.docx
- 第六单元跨学科实践活动5基于碳中和理念设计低碳行动方案教学设计-2024-2025学年九年级化学人教版上册.docx
文档评论(0)